Nylabone Dental Chews™ are designed to reduce the incidence of periodontal disease in dogs by massaging gums and scraping and cleaning teeth of food particles and tartar. The result is a healthier mouth and fresher breath.
The Dental Chew bone has round and pliable dental nubs on all sides. These chews massage the gums and stimulate an increase of healthy fluids and saliva flow in the mouth. Friction against the teeth helps remove food debris and bacteria that leads to calculus formation.
Dental Chew bones are designed only for soft and average chewing dogs. Soft chewers normally gnaw at their bones, and do not bite them into pieces. If your dog chews off pieces of the bone, throw it away and replace the Dental Chew with a larger size.

You, as the pet owner, best know your dog's chew power and needs. Regular use of Nylabones will increase your dog's jaw strength and may require larger, more durable bones.
- Make sure the Nylabone® is the appropriate size for your dog. (Petite < 10 lbs.; Regular/Wolf < 25 lbs.; Giant < 50 lbs.; Souper > 50 lbs.). Replace smaller chews as your puppy grows, and Nylabone "puppy bones" should not be used by dogs with adult teeth.
- Inspect your Nylabone® before giving it to your dog to make sure it's whole and intact. Inspect it frequently as your dog uses it, paying particular attention to missing pieces that could be harmful if swallowed whole.
- No dog toy or chew is indestructible. If you think your dog swallowed a chew fragment larger than 1/4 inch, promptly inform your veterinarian.
- Do not give soft rubber or flexible Nylabones® to aggressive chewers; they should have Nylabone® Durables™. Healthy Edibles™ are not recommended for puppies < 3 months.
- Clean your dog's Nylabone® occasionally. Rinse under warm water - another chance to inspect for potential problems.
- Replace the Nylabone® if it becomes too small or damaged in any way or the knuckles are worn down.
- Provide variety for your dog - rotate the Nylabone® chews and toys you offer and supervise the use of toys; your dog's health and safety are your responsibility.
- If you have multiple dogs and they share the chews, give them the type and size for the largest, most aggressive chewer.
- Nylabone® products, other than the Healthy Edibles™ line, are NOT intended as edible. During normal chewing, tiny bristle-like projections are raised which help clean the teeth. If ingested, these should pass through without effect.
- Nylabones® should not be used by young children, pets other than dogs, boiled, or placed in a dishwasher, washing machine, convection or microwave oven (except Edibles where noted).
